Description

The Humboldt District Hospital Foundation is a charitable organization that fundraises to support equipment purchases for the Humboldt District Health Complex.  We are searching for a permanent part time Executive Director Assistant to join our team!

About this position:
The Executive Director Assistant will provide support and work closely with the Executive Director.  The job-holders work includes accounting, charitable tax receipting, assist with event planning, fundraising and provide administrative support at meetings.

The position offers a minimum of 28 hours per week however may increase in peak times.

MAIN DUTIES
Develop knowledge and maintain knowledge on charitable organizations.
Provide and maintain positive relations with current and potential donors, volunteers and health care workers.
Lead on the administrative aspects of day-to-day operations (banking, accounting, meeting minutes, filing)
Maintain donor database.
Respond flexibly and actively to evolving priorities and needs.
Occasional out of hours/weekend working will be required, with time off given in lieu of hours worked.
